Title: **Helmut Timmermann: Innovator in Mineral Processing Technology**
Introduction
Helmut Timmermann, based in Bochum, Germany, is a prominent inventor recognized for his contributions to mineral processing technology. With two patents to his name, Timmermann's innovative approaches have advanced the efficiency of jigging processes used in the treatment of minerals such as coal.
Latest Patents
Timmermann's latest patents include a jigging screen device with pneumatic valve control and an air pillow in the air chambers of a bottom pulsed jigging machine. The patented method and apparatus focus on treating minerals in a jig bed with a downwardly opening air chamber. This design incorporates a cushioned pillow of air that enhances the operation of the jig by controlling air admission and relief within the chamber. The innovative mechanism allows for more effective water management, particularly at the start of the jig's operation, thereby optimizing the treatment process.
